## Calendar Sync Conflicts

If you're on call for Tindervale Scheduler, the most common page is a calendar sync conflict: two agents write overlapping event versions and the merge job stalls. Check the conflict queue depth first; anything over 200 means the merge worker is wedged. Restart it, then replay the stuck batch. To inspect the conflict rows directly, connect to the sync-state database using the connection string below.

primary connection of yagep-kahip = redis://giliel_svc:zYiKsLL2PLpfPL@db-348f.xolmarsys.corp:5432/fenwyn

Always run the shadow-assignment comparison for at least one peak hour before promoting. If assignments start clustering in one zone post-release, roll back first and investigate second — don't try to hot-tune the weights in prod. Known failure modes, the shadow-run procedure, and historical tuning decisions are all written up on the following internal page.

wiki page, tagef-bajog: https://grafana.nelvrocorp.corp/projects/pages/display/fa238a928afe

**Mgmt Meeting Minutes — Retiring the Brightline Range**

Quick recap for sales leads at Fenholt Supplies: we agreed to retire the Brightline fixture range by year-end. Remaining stock moves to clearance pricing next month, and accounts on standing orders get migrated to the Lumetta range. Trade-in incentives were approved in principle. The confidential note on next steps sits just below.

board note of bajof-bajeg: The pricing group signed off on a budget of $13.4 million for Project Sildor. The renewal with Lamixek Holdings closes at $48.9 million a year, 49 percent above the last contract.

Hey Priya — handing over the shuttle-bus gate stuff before I head off. The gate arm at the Westfold car park has been sticking in the mornings, so give it a nudge-reset from the control box if drivers radio in. Contractor from Hartlew Barriers is due Thursday to replace the motor; please escort them and log the visit. If the reader plays up again, the manual override keypad takes the code below.

door code, yagap-bahof: bdg-O-05